What two things are being compared?

“In a smithy

one sees a white-hot axehead or an adze

 plunged and wrung in a cold tub, screeching steam-the way they make soft iron hale and hard—:just so 

that eyeball hissed around the spike.”

 an extremely hot tool being dipped in cold water to the cyclops' eye popping when it got stabbed by the hot wood

What two things are being compared in the epic simile from book 5?



“A gull patrolling 

between wave crests of the desolate sea

will dip to catch a fish, and douse his wings;

no higher above Hermes flew”

The way a seagull flies over water to the way Hermes flew to deliver his message
